UAPB vs. University of Maine-Machias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, UAPB or University of Maine-Machias?

  • University of Maine at Machias is 30.3% more expensive to attend than UAPB for in-state tuition ($7,350.00 vs. $5,640.00)
  • Out of state tuition is 14.8% higher at University of Maine-Machias than University of Arkansas at Pine Bluff ($14,700.00 vs. $12,810.00)
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at University of Maine at Machias are 2.7% lower than costs at University of Arkansas at Pine Bluff ($8,630 vs. $8,866)
  • More students receive financial grant aid at University of Arkansas at Pine Bluff than University of Maine at Machias (100% vs. 0%)

UAPB vs. University of Maine-Machias Graduation Outcomes Comparison

Which is better, UAPB or University of Maine-Machias? Graduation rate, salary and amount of student loan debt are indicators of a college which offers better outcomes for its graduates. Compare the following outcomes facts between University of Maine-Machias and UAPB.

  • The graduation rate at University of Maine-Machias is higher than University of Arkansas at Pine Bluff (38% vs. 23%)
  • Graduates from University of Arkansas at Pine Bluff earn on average $2,700 more per year than University of Maine-Machias graduates after ten years. ($30,200 vs. $27,500)
  • University of Maine at Machias students graduate with a $3,998 lower median federal student loan debt than UAPB graduates. ($22,750 vs. $26,748)
  • University of Maine-Machias graduates are paying $41 less per month on federal student loans than UAPB graduates. ($235 vs. $276)
  • More University of Maine-Machias graduates are actively paying back their federal student loan debt than former UAPB students, three years after graduation. (55% vs. 30%)
